Position Summary
The Field Service Technician is responsible for ensuring users of our equipment are satisfied with its performance by providing prompt onsite or in-depot service by performing commissioning, troubleshooting repair service, and training support on dry ice production equipment, dry ice blasting machines, and engineered systems at customer facilities throughout their region (Ohio).
